import'package:flutter/material.dart';import'bottom_navigation_widget.dart';voidmain() =>runApp(MyApp());classMyAppextendsStatelessWidget {constMyApp({Key key}) :super(key: key); @override Widget build(BuildContext context) {returnMaterialApp( title:'flutter底部导航', theme: ThemeData.light(),...
import'package:flutter/material.dart';import'bottom_navigation_widget.dart';voidmain() =>runApp(MyApp());classMyAppextendsStatelessWidget {constMyApp({Key key}) :super(key: key); @override Widget build(BuildContext context) {returnMaterialApp( title:'flutter底部导航', theme: ThemeData.light(),...
先来搭建一下我的界面,目前我的界面是一个空壳: 而最终要的效果是这样: 下面先来搭建界面: 菜单数据准备: 先定义元素文本及图标: import 'package:flutter/material.dart'; class ProfilePage extends StatefulWidget { @override _ProfilePageState createState() => _ProfilePageState(); } class _ProfilePageSt...
Flutter中BottomNavigationBar类似于 iOS 中的UITabbarController,是导航控制器的一种,常用于首页 Tab 切换。 莫空9081 2021/08/18 3.1K0 【Flutter】Flutter 布局组件 ( Wrap 组件 | Expanded 组件 ) flutter博客布局翻译源码 Wrap 组件 : 该组件是可换行的水平线性布局组件 , 与 Row 组件间类似 , 但是可以换行...
BottomNavigationBar是底部导航条,可以让我们定义底部Tab切换,bottomNatigationBar是Scaffold组件的参数。 BottomNavigationBar常见属性 实现一个页面切换功能目录 main.dart import 'package:flutter/material.dart'; import 'package:stack_align_positioned/pages/Tabs.dart'; ...
1.BottomNavigationBar BottomNavigationBar是底部的导航栏,用于在3到5个的少量视图中进行选择。一般情况下,导航栏的选项卡由文本标签、图标或两者结合的形式组成。 底部导航栏通常与javaScaffold结合使用,它会作为Scaffold.bottomNavigationBar参数。 import'package:flutter/material.dart';voidmain()=>runApp(MyApp())...
「Convex Bottom Bar」是一种 Flutter 包装。Convex Bottom 的底部条是一个应用程序栏草图这样的方式,有一个 convex Bottom 状它。它可以使用户界面看起来很棒,也可以改进用户与界面的交互方式。在本文中,我们将构建一个简单的应用程序与最简单的形式之一的「Convex Bottom Bar」。
4. BottomNavigationBar 组件 4.1 容器创建 优雅的编程,首先创建一个 bottomnavigationbar.dart 文件。由于之后有页面效果变化,所以这里继承 StatefulWidgets。 import'package:flutter/material.dart';classFMBottomNavBarVCextendsStatefulWidget{@overrideFMBottomNavBarStatecreateState()=>FMBottomNavBarState();}classFM...
在Flutter中封装BottomNavigationBar组件,可以让我们更方便地在多个页面之间切换,并保持底部导航栏的一致性。以下是一个详细的步骤指南,帮助你封装一个自定义的BottomNavigationBar组件: 1. 理解BottomNavigationBar组件的基本用法和属性 BottomNavigationBar是Flutter提供的一个底部导航栏组件,它允许用户在不同的视图或页面之...
BottomNavigationBar组件属性及描述 写一个简单的demo,底部导航放置3个选项卡,每点击一个选项卡,屏幕中间的文案随之变化,先看下代码和结果,然后讲一下代码的内容。 import'package:flutter/material.dart'; import'package:fluttertoast/fluttertoast.dart';voidmain() =>runApp(DemoApp());classDemoApp extends Stat...